Bobby is an associate attorney at Bercow Radell Fernandez & Larkin focusing on land use and zoning matters.
He earned his Juris Doctor from Florida International University College of Law. During law school, Bobby earned a Master’s Degree in Business Administration, with a concentration in International Business. While there, he competed in state-wide business competitions creating and presenting business plans for local and national companies working throughout the State of Florida.
Bobby used his time away from formal studies to work with local governments to develop his knowledge in areas he is passionate about, working as an intern in the Coral Gables City Attorney’s office and in the Miami City Attorney’s office in the Land Use and Transactional Division.
Bobby is involved in several professional organizations including the Cuban American Bar Association; CABA Young Lawyers Division; FIU Law Alumni Association; FIU Alumni Association; and the Sigma Phi Epsilon Alumni Association, where he serves as a volunteer mentor for students.
